[PATCH 08/14] i2c: at91-i2c: include arch specific clk.h only for AT91

Robert Marko robert.marko at sartura.hr
Thu Mar 26 12:26:49 CET 2026


Microchip LAN969x will not include any arch specific clk.h, so in order to
support it only include <asm/arch/clk.h> when AT91 is selected.

Signed-off-by: Robert Marko <robert.marko at sartura.hr>
---
 drivers/i2c/at91_i2c.c |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/drivers/i2c/at91_i2c.c b/drivers/i2c/at91_i2c.c
index cfae36c74d1..6c002b21e6c 100644
--- a/drivers/i2c/at91_i2c.c
+++ b/drivers/i2c/at91_i2c.c
@@ -14,7 +14,9 @@
 #include <fdtdec.h>
 #include <i2c.h>
 #include <linux/bitops.h>
+#if IS_ENABLED(CONFIG_ARCH_AT91)
 #include <mach/clk.h>
+#endif
 
 #include "at91_i2c.h"
 
-- 
2.53.0



More information about the U-Boot mailing list